Claims
- 1. A time delay release mechanism controlled by an electrical power source and connected to a fire barrier biased to close when power to said time delay release mechanism is interrupted for a predetermined time period, said time delay release mechanism comprising:
- an actuation member movable between an engaged position and a released position, said actuation member being operatively engageable with the fire barrier such that when said actuation member is in said engaged position said actuation member prevents closure of the fire barrier and when said actuation member is in said released position, said actuation member allows closure of the fire barrier;
- magnetic means mechanically connected to said actuation member for maintaining said actuation member in said engaged position when power is supplied to said magnetic means and for moving said actuation member to said released position when power is no longer supplied to said magnetic means; and
- an energy storage timer electrically connected to the electrical power source and to said magnetic means for providing power to said magnetic means such that when one of (a) said timer receives power for a duration less than the predetermined time period, and (b) when power to said timer is interrupted for a duration less than the predetermined time period, said magnetic means maintains said actuation member in said engaged position, and when power to said timer is interrupted for a duration greater than the predetermined time period, said magnetic means causes said actuation member to move to said released position to allow closure of the fire barrier, said magnetic means returning said actuation member to said engaged position when power is restored to said timer, thereby automatically resetting said brake actuation member.
- 2. The time delay release mechanism of claim 1, wherein said timer comprises a capacitor having a capacitive value and wherein the predetermined time period is determined by the capacitive value of said capacitor.
- 3. The time delay release mechanism of claim 1, wherein said actuation member comprises an actuator of a solenoid.
- 4. The time delay release mechanism of claim 3, wherein said solenoid comprises a solenoid arm and wherein said magnetic means is releasably connected to said solenoid arm for allowing movement of said actuator between the engaged and disengaged positions.
